Drizly is like Door Dash or Uber Eats with food delivery from local restaurants. Instead of food though, it's alcohol delivery from local liquor stores. If you have a favorite bottle of wine, tequila, or whatever beverage you're feeling you want to be delivered. Download the app, because many Toms River liquor stores use Drizly.

The Toms River liquor stores that use Drizly, according to drizly.com, are Spirits Unlimited Crossroads, Spirits Unlimited Fischer Blvd., Spirits Unlimited Rt. 37, Spirits Unlimited Rt. 9, Super Buy Rite, Silverton, and Super Buy Rite of Toms River.

Here's how it works.

When you have the Drizly app downloaded and ready to go, check out the web browser for your favorite beer, wine, or liquor delivered right to your doorstep in under 60 minutes. It's a contactless delivery and in case you didn't know alcohol delivery is legal in New Jersey.
